Who are OpenSanctions.org's subprocessors?
OpenSanctions.org lists 11 subprocessors on its trust center, including Google Cloud Platform, HubSpot Germany GmbH, Stripe, Inc., Datev eG, Ory Networks, Inc.. Buyers use this for fourth-party risk review.
Where does OpenSanctions.org host or store data?
OpenSanctions.org hosts on GCP, and handles Customer personally identifiable information, Employee personally identifiable information, Credit card information, Personal health information. Data residency details are on its trust center.
